How they compare
China currently reports 67.83 against 66.34 in Samoa, a difference of 1.49.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 19 shared years of data; in 2006 it was Samoa ahead.
China ranks 41st and Samoa ranks 44th of 168 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, China averaged higher in 2 and Samoa in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| China | Samoa |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 14.25 | 16.59 | 2.34 | Samoa |
| 2010s | 62.93 | 38.97 | 23.96 | China |
| 2020s | 77.05 | 59.98 | 17.06 | China |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
